{"product_id":"mcp4728-12-bit-4-channel-dac-module-i2c-interface","title":"MCP4728 12-Bit 4-Channel DAC Module - I2C Interface","description":"\u003ch1\u003eMCP4728 12-Bit 4-Channel DAC with I2C and EEPROM\u003c\/h1\u003e\n\n\u003cp\u003eThe MCP4728 is a quad-channel, 12-bit digital-to-analog converter with on‑board EEPROM and an I2C interface. It provides four independent analog voltage outputs from a single device, making it ideal for precision control applications such as sensor simulation, waveform generation, and voltage calibration. With built‑in reference options and low power consumption, it integrates seamlessly into microcontroller projects.\u003c\/p\u003e\n\n\u003ch2\u003eKey Specifications\u003c\/h2\u003e\n\u003ctable\u003e\n  \u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eSpecification\u003c\/th\u003e\n\u003cth\u003eValue\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n  \u003ctbody\u003e\n    \u003ctr\u003e\n\u003ctd\u003eResolution\u003c\/td\u003e\n\u003ctd\u003e12 bits\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eChannels\u003c\/td\u003e\n\u003ctd\u003e4\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eInterface\u003c\/td\u003e\n\u003ctd\u003eI2C (address selectable via A0 pin)\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eSupply Voltage\u003c\/td\u003e\n\u003ctd\u003e2.7V to 5.5V\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eInternal Reference\u003c\/td\u003e\n\u003ctd\u003e2.048V (can use external VREF)\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eEEPROM\u003c\/td\u003e\n\u003ctd\u003eIntegrated (stores DAC settings)\u003c\/td\u003e\n\u003c\/tr\u003e\n  \u003c\/tbody\u003e\n\u003c\/table\u003e\n\n\u003ch2\u003eWhat You Can Build With This\u003c\/h2\u003e\n\u003cul\u003e\n  \u003cli\u003eProgrammable multi‑channel voltage source for testing\u003c\/li\u003e\n  \u003cli\u003e\u003ca href=\"\/products\/esp32-waveform-generator-kit-build-4-waveforms-with-web-ui\"\u003eAudio waveform generator (e.g., sine, square, triangle)\u003c\/a\u003e\u003c\/li\u003e\n  \u003cli\u003eSensor output simulator (e.g., pressure, temperature)\u003c\/li\u003e\n  \u003cli\u003ePrecision LED brightness control with multiple independent channels\u003c\/li\u003e\n\u003c\/ul\u003e\n\n\u003ch2\u003eCompatibility\u003c\/h2\u003e\n\u003cp\u003eThis DAC operates on 3.3V and 5V logic, making it fully compatible with Arduino, Raspberry Pi, ESP32, and any microcontroller that supports I2C. The module works out of the box with the standard Wire library on Arduino and the smbus2 library on Raspberry Pi.\u003c\/p\u003e\n\n\u003ch2\u003eWiring Notes\u003c\/h2\u003e\n\u003cp\u003eConnect VCC to 3.3V or 5V, GND to ground, and SDA\/SCL to your microcontroller's I2C pins. The module includes onboard pull‑up resistors, so external pull‑ups are not required for most setups. For external reference, connect a stable voltage (up to VCC) to the VREF pin; leave it unconnected to use the internal 2.048V reference.\u003c\/p\u003e\n\n\u003ch2\u003eWhy Buy from Compoden\u003c\/h2\u003e\n\u003cp\u003eEvery component is sourced from verified suppliers and tested for compatibility before listing. If defective on arrival, replace within 7 days.\u003c\/p\u003e\n\n\u003cdetails\u003e\u003csummary\u003eIs this compatible with Arduino?\u003c\/summary\u003e\u003cp\u003eYes, the MCP4728 module works directly with Arduino using the Wire library. Set the I2C address (default 0x60) and send 12‑bit values for each channel.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details\u003e\u003csummary\u003eCan I use an external voltage reference?\u003c\/summary\u003e\u003cp\u003eAbsolutely. The VREF pin allows an external reference up to the supply voltage. When an external reference is applied, the internal 2.048V reference is automatically overridden.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details\u003e\u003csummary\u003eDoes it retain settings after power is removed?\u003c\/summary\u003e\u003cp\u003eYes. The integrated EEPROM stores DAC register values and configuration bits, so your last settings are restored upon power-up if saved before shutdown.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div class=\"compoden-handoff\" style=\"margin-top:24px;padding:16px;background:#f0f4ff;border-left:4px solid #2B4D8F;border-radius:4px;\"\u003e\n  \u003cp style=\"margin:0 0 6px 0;font-weight:600;color:#1A3560;\"\u003e📦 Free Setup Handoff Document Included\u003c\/p\u003e\n  \u003cp style=\"margin:0;font-size:0.95em;color:#333;\"\u003eEvery Compoden order includes a free setup handoff document — step-by-step instructions to get your component working within minutes.
